MeetingRooms

An app that fetches fake meeting room data and allows to book any of the rooms that have available spots. Built as a code challenge assignment for WeTransfer.

3 hour requirement

This repo has 2 branches: main and beyond-3-hour-limit. Whatever you see in the main branch is what I've accomplished approximately within the first 3 hours of work.

There were some important parts that I couldn't finish in time, such as caching and unit testing. Instead of describing how I would have approached them, I decided to actually implement them in a separate branch so that you could have a look at them if you wish.

To review the part of the project implemented within the 3 hour limit, feel free to clone the repo and just review the main branch. To review the complete project, feel free either to checkout the beyond-3-hour-limit branch or have a look at the PR I opened.

Technologies used

  • Xcode v14.3.1
  • Minimum deployment target iOS 16.4 (since it wasn't required to support older versions in the spec)
  • Swift 5.8
  • SPM for modularization and remote dependencies
  • SwiftUI
  • async / await
  • Very limited usage of Combine (in the beyond-3-hour-limit branch)
  • URLSession (since required networking was very simple, I decided not to go for Alamofire)
  • Nuke for image caching

Architecture

The architecture I decided to go with is MVVM. Was it a bigger project, I would have gone for an MVVM-C. However, in this specific case it didn't make sense because C (coordinator) would never be used, since there is no navigation involved in the app.

Project structure

Instead of building everything in a single Xcode target, I decided to take a modular approach with the use of Swift Package Manager.

The only Swift file the project contains in the original target is MeetingRoomsManager.swift. Everything else is implemented in a local SPM package called Modules.

Modules structure is specified in its Package.swift. A more detailed description of each component of the package:

Modules (aka Targets)

  • Cloud - a module that contains all the networking related logic (and additionally a networking monitoring logic that was built in beyond-3-hour-limit branch)
  • DesignSystem - a module that contains all the reusable UI components and UI-related extensions
  • RoomManager - a module that contains all the logic for room fetching and booking use cases
  • Rooms - a module that contains all the screen logic (views and view models)
  • Utilities - a module that contains all the non-UI extensions and utilities needed for any of the modules

Modules built in beyond-3-hour-limi branch

  • Datastore - a module that contains logic that saves/loads/deletes data on disk to meet the caching requiremenet for use case when there is no internet connection
  • RoomManagerTests - a module that contains all the unit tests for logic in the RoomManager module (decoding/encoding of the Room models & RoomManager tests)
  • RoomsTests - a module that contains unit tests for view models of the Rooms module
  • Datastore - a module that contains unit tests for the Datastore logic (saving/loading/deleting of objects on and from disk)

Libraries (aka Products)

In the main branch you can see that there are only 2 libraries that are necessary to start the app:

  • Rooms - needed to be specified as a library to make it importable by MeetingRoomsApp to present the MeetingRoomsView screen
  • DesignSystem - needed to be specified as a library to make the Previews work when developing components

Libraries built in beyond-3-hour-limi branch

  • Cloud - needed to be specified as a library so that MeetingRoomsApp could trigger the network monitoring start

Dependencies

  • Nuke - for image caching (I decided to save time on image caching instead of building my own solution)

What I could have improved even further the beyond-3-hour-limit branch

  • Datastore could have an additional way to save/load/delete objects without a key based on their ids (would have to be Identifiable)
  • Datastore could have more logic to not only save on disk but also on RAM for a more efficient usage of cache data throughout app's life cycle (an overkill for this project though)
  • Could have utilised the logic in NetworkingMonitor in a richer way and not even make the first request if I know that there is no connection, showing a placeholder saying there is no connection
  • Could have built a more sophisticated CloudManager that would allow to specify request headers, methods, parse errors into different types etc. (an overkill for this project)
  • RoundedButton could have a State enum for default, loading, disabled states representing different UI and animations
  • Could have a built a nicer UI for the header of the screen where title transitions into a navigation bar on scroll. Didn't go for it to save time, and also I'd have to do it in a custom way to keep using the Helvetica font. If I was using the system font I might have just used the NavigationView + .navigationBarTitle() modifier with a default displayMode that has that behaviour built in.
  • Could have tested more logic such as CloudManager, NetworkingMonitor, RoundedButtonViewModel etc.
